Chelsea midfielder Ruben Loftus-Cheek was left stunned by Casemiro’s equalising goal at Stamford Bridge last night.

Casemiro scored a header to make it 1-1 in stoppage-time to cancel out Jorginho’s penalty, which was scored seven minutes earlier, so there was a lot of late action for fans to soak in.

A chipped cross from Luke Shaw found Casemiro in a position to score his first goal for United, and it is one we won’t be forgetting anytime soon as it secured an important point on the road.

In many ways, the goal epitomises Casemiro’s influence on the game as he grabbed it by the scruff of the neck, which is what Ten Hag brought him in to do in the summer.

Ruben Loftus-Cheek stunned by late Casemiro goal

A United goal was always coming, especially since the early stages which we dominated.

Casemiro led by example and kept gunning until the end.

Speaking to the official Chelsea website, Loftus-Cheek said: “It was just one of those games, but I thought we had it [the win], we were defending well and then to be honest I don’t know how Casemiro’s got the power on that header to send it up and down. It feels like a defeat.”
